When I marinade, I use the following:
1/3 cup Dale's Steak Marinade
1/3 cup Lemon Juice
1/3 cup Red Wine vinegar
1 tsp liquid smoke (only when I am grilling the steaks - not when I am smoking then reverse seering them)
4 or 5 drops of Tobasco Sauce
1 or 2 shakes of Garlic Powder
